Laramie, Wyoming, is a charming city located in ZIP Code 82073, known for its stunning natural landscapes and rich history. For those considering a move to this area, it's essential to understand the healthcare amenities available, especially for individuals with Type 2 Diabetes.

Type 2 Diabetes is a chronic condition that affects how the body processes blood sugar (glucose). It can lead to serious health complications if not managed properly. Access to healthcare services is crucial for individuals with Type 2 Diabetes, as regular check-ups and monitoring are essential for managing the condition.

In Laramie, residents have access to several healthcare facilities that cater to a variety of medical needs. The Ivinson Memorial Hospital is a prominent healthcare provider in the area, offering a range of services including primary care, specialty care, and emergency services. The hospital is equipped to handle the needs of individuals with Type 2 Diabetes, providing diagnostic testing, treatment options, and ongoing care.

In addition to the hospital, Laramie is home to several clinics and medical practices that offer diabetes management services. These facilities provide access to healthcare professionals such as endocrinologists, dietitians, and diabetes educators who specialize in helping individuals manage their condition effectively.

As for the history of Laramie, the city has deep roots dating back to the mid-19th century when it was established as a key stop along the Union Pacific Railroad. Over the years, Laramie has evolved into a vibrant community known for its cultural attractions, educational institutions, and strong sense of community pride.
